PE will be a Leaving Cert subject in 6 Tipp schools

There are warnings that the new PE curriculum won’t work if there isn’t a change in the way teachers are educated.

80 schools around the country will begin the course this September, in a bid to tackle rising obesity rates.

- Advertisement -

In Tipperary students from the Loreto in Clonmel, Rockwell college, Borrisokane Community college, the Presentation secondary schools in Thurles and Ballingarry and the Abbey in Tipperary, will have the opportunity to study the subject.

But DCU professor of Health and Human Performance Niall Moyna says the change needs to begin with teachers
